leaving the car lifted on a hoist does not cause the ride quality change. if it had active suspension, it has to be switched off first to prevent the ride height control from extending and contracting the actuators repeatedly
altis does not have active suspension like the mid 90s sports and luxury editions with TEMS- toyota electronically modulated suspension
